Description
Eve Three Shot Premium is a formulation designed to be effective against painful headaches, menstrual pain, and stiff shoulders. Contains 195mg of the double analgesic ingredients of ibuprofen and acetaminophen (as a single dose for adults). Adopts a unique quick-action tablet technology that achieves rapid dissolution of ibuprofen. Contains magnesium oxide (a gastric mucosal protective ingredient) that protects the stomach, and does not contain ingredients that make you sleepy.

Ingredients
In 3 tablets: Ibuprofen: 195mg, Acetaminophen: 195mg, Magnesium oxide: 70mg, Anhydrous caffeine: 65mg. Additives: Silicic anhydride, cellulose, hydroxypropyl cellulose, hypromellose, crospovidone, macrogol, Mg stearate, talc, titanium oxide
Benefits
Headaches, menstrual pain (menstrual pain), stiff shoulders, toothache, sore throat (sore throat), joint pain, muscle pain, neuralgia, lower back pain, pain after tooth extraction, bruise pain, ear pain, fracture pain, pain associated with sprains (sprain pain), pain relief for trauma pain, chills (chills due to fever), fever relief in case of fever.
Directions
Take the following doses at most twice a day, preferably with water or lukewarm water, avoiding empty stomach. Please wait at least 6 hours between doses. [Age: 1 dose] Adults (15 years and older): 3 tablets. Under 15 years of age: Do not take. Precautions related to usage and administration. (1) Please strictly follow the directions and dosage. (2) How to take out the tablet Press the convex part of the PTP sheet containing the tablet firmly with your fingertips to break the aluminum foil on the back, take it out and drink. (If you accidentally swallow it whole, it may pierce the esophageal mucosa or cause an unexpected accident.)
Do Not Use If
(Failure to do so may worsen current symptoms or cause side effects or accidents.) 1. The following people should not take this remedy. (1) Persons who have had allergic symptoms due to this drug or its ingredients. (2) People who have had asthma while taking this drug or other antipyretic analgesics or cold remedies. (3) Children under 15 years of age. (4) Pregnant women within 12 weeks of due date. 2.Do not take any of the following remedies while taking this drug. Other antipyretic analgesics, cold remedies, and calming. 3.Do not drink alcohol before or after taking this remedy. 4.Do not use it for a long time.
Things to consult 1. The following people should consult a doctor, dentist, pharmacist, or registered salesperson before taking the drug. (1) People who are receiving treatment from a doctor or dentist. (2) Pregnant women or people who appear to be pregnant. (3) People who are breastfeeding. (4) Elderly people. (5) Persons who have had allergic symptoms due to remedies, etc. (6) Persons who have received the following diagnosis. Heart disease, kidney disease, liver disease, systemic lupus erythematosus, mixed connective tissue disease. (7) Persons who have had the following diseases. Gastric/duodenal ulcer, ulcerative colitis, Crohn's disease. 2. If the following symptoms appear after taking this remedy, it may be a side effect, so please stop taking it immediately and consult your doctor, dentist, pharmacist, or registered salesperson with this instruction manual. [Related areas: Symptoms] Skin: Rash, redness, itching, and bruising may occur. Gastrointestinal: Nausea/vomiting, loss of appetite, stomach discomfort, stomach pain, stomatitis, heartburn, heaviness in the stomach, gastrointestinal bleeding, abdominal pain, diarrhea, bloody stools. Neuropsychiatric system: Dizziness. Cardiovascular system: palpitations. Respiratory: Shortness of breath. Others: Blurred vision, ringing in the ears, swelling, nosebleeds, bleeding gums, difficulty in stopping bleeding, bleeding, back pain, excessive drop in body temperature, feeling tired. In rare cases, the following serious symptoms may occur. In that case, please see a doctor immediately. [Symptom name] Shock (anaphylaxis)...Immediately after taking the drug, symptoms such as itchy skin, hives, hoarseness, sneezing, itchy throat, difficulty breathing, palpitations, and clouded consciousness may appear. Mucocutaneous oculomucocutaneous syndrome (Stevens-Johnson syndrome), toxic epidermal necrolysis, acute generalized exanthematous pustulosis... High fever, bloodshot eyes, eye discharge, sore lips, sore throat, widespread rash/redness on the skin, small bumps (pustules) appearing on reddened skin, general malaise, loss of appetite, etc. that persist or worsen rapidly. Drug-induced hypersensitivity syndrome: Symptoms include widespread redness of the skin, generalized rash, fever, malaise, and swelling of the lymph nodes (neck, armpits, groin, etc.). Liver dysfunction: Fever, itching, rash, jaundice (yellowing of the skin and whites of the eyes), brown urine, general malaise, loss of appetite, etc. may appear. Kidney disorder: Fever, rash, decreased urine output, general swelling, general malaise, joint pain (pain in the joints), diarrhea, etc. may appear. Aseptic meningitis: Severe headache accompanied by stiffness in the neck, fever, nausea, and vomiting appear. (Such symptoms are particularly frequently reported in people receiving treatment for systemic lupus erythematosus or mixed connective tissue disease.) Myocardial infarction: Severe chest pain, shortness of breath, and cold sweats. Cerebrovascular disorder: A sudden onset of symptoms such as decreased or lost consciousness, difficulty moving one limb, headache, vomiting, dizziness, difficulty speaking, and difficulty speaking. Interstitial pneumonia: When you climb stairs or push yourself too hard, you experience shortness of breath, difficulty breathing, dry cough, and fever, which appear suddenly or persist. Asthma: wheezing, whistling, and difficulty breathing when breathing. Aplastic anemia: Bruises, nosebleeds, bleeding gums, fever, pale skin and mucous membranes, fatigue, palpitations, shortness of breath, feeling sick and dizzy, blood in the urine, etc. appear. Agranulocytosis: Sudden onset of high fever, chills, sore throat, etc. 3. The following symptoms may appear after taking this remedy. If these symptoms persist or worsen, please stop taking this remedy and consult your doctor, pharmacist, or registered salesperson with this instruction manual: Constipation. 4. If your symptoms do not improve after taking 3 to 4 times, please stop taking this remedy and consult your doctor, dentist, pharmacist, or registered salesperson with this instruction manual.
